堆石灌浆圬工是旧有的砌石圬工在施工方法上一个带有根本性质的革新。它与普通混凝土比较并無本质之差别,但从施工而言具有更进一步的技术经济优点。本文提出一种面浇法堆石灌浆圬工,较升浆法在设备上和操作上更为简化,特别有利于在偏僻地区零星工程的施工获得多快好省的效果,经实验证明是可行的。与以往所有资料有原则性不同,本文是联系了石块间孔道的特性来解决灌浆用灰砂浆的流度问题,建立起一套新的理论概念;并对其他各种测定流度的方法及仪器给予批判性的估价。此外,还找到所需流度与估计用水量之间关系的一般性规律。对如何尽可能地节约水泥用量,本文作者亦提了建议。最后作出相应的四点结论,可供参考。
